A school
district must have high standards for student achievement. For the
last four decades the Kansas City, Missouri School District has failed
to achieve this goal for the community's children.
Change can only be accomplished by recreating the school district;
breaking up the KCMSD into a suggested five smaller more manageable
school districts.
In four decades the present KCMSD has had nineteen different
superintendents, not counting the one to replace Mr. Taylor---- most of
those in the last ten years.
The KCMSD has a proven track record of failure and lowering its
standards. It is time to make a real difference, time to make a
change.
